Paire de grands candélabres en bronze patiné et bronze doré d'époque Restauration, vers 1820

Description
- patinated and giltbronze
- Haut 111 cm, diam. bouquet de lumières 37,5 cm
- Height 43 3/4 in; branches diam. 14 3/4 in
figurant Bacchus et une bacchante, chacun tenant un thyrse supportant sept bras de lumière, ornés de têtes de bouc et de pampres de vigne ; reposant sur un socle octogonal orné de pampres et bacchantes ; (socles percés pour l'électricité)
Condition
Illustration is accurate.
Gilt-bronze mounts with very few wear : small spots of oxidation on the branches, few tiny stains and inevitable scratches on the bases.
Patinated bronzes with a beautiful and deep colour, and only slight scratches in places.
The cup and the ewer with a little loose (need to be refixed).
One small hole in each pedestal (possibly a small element missing).
Spectacular candelabra in very good condition, highly decorative.

Catalogue Note
Ce modèle s'inspire probablement des gravures de l'ornemaniste et architecte Charles Normand (1765-1840) dont une planche, publiée dans Modèles d'Orfèvrerie choisis aux expositions des Produits de l'industrie française au Louvre (Paris, 1822), reproduit quatre exemplaires de girandoles exposés en 1819 (ill. dans H. Ottomeyer et P. Pröschel, Vergoldete Bronzen, t.I, p.390, 5.17.1).
